Transaction 00667ebaf6ed6866460a0b97e7641cb88b49259b28cfc252b2faa586b0fa9895
1 Input
1 Output
-
00667ebaf6ed6866460a0b97e7641cb88b49259b28cfc252b2faa586b0fa9895:0
- value
- 540628
- script pubkey
- OP_0 OP_PUSHBYTES_20 060e9a8fa40a47034c99bf8219326c3c624e28e2
- address
- bc1qqc8f4raypfrsxnyeh7ppjvnv833yu28ztdexkv